The Uruguay Open is a tennis tournament held in Montevideo, Uruguay since 2005. The event is part of the ATP Challenger Tour and is played on outdoor clay courts. This is the successor tournament to the earlier Uruguay International Championships (1936–1970),[2] that was last played at the Carrasco Lawn Tennis Club.
